Classic Alex
Maybe a little politically incorrect for today's viewers but Michael J. Fox shines in this episode. Lots of great one liners. A great guest performance by character actress Gail Strickland. One of my favorite episodes from maybe the best season in the series. Tracy Nelson also just adorable!
Alex is trying to impress a feminist classmate (Nelson) by falsely supporting the local ERA movement. Things go rogue when he defends Dorothy's (Strickland) right to be heard in a protest between both sides of a local demonstration.
Some of the funniest moments include the lead in doll house scene with Jennifer and Mallory and Stephen telling Elyse if it was Karl instead of Deena Marx on the phone he would like to have a word with him 😂
